What is CVE-2017-10001?
An exploitable flaw exists in Oracle Hospitality Simphony First Edition within the Core component, specifically in version 1.7.1. This vulnerability permits a low-privileged attacker with network access via HTTP to compromise the system, requiring human interaction from a third party to successfully execute an attack. When exploited, this vulnerability can lead to unauthorized access to critical data, allowing the attacker to manipulate data through insert, update, or delete operations. It also opens up risks for denial-of-service conditions, including crashing the application. Proper security measures must be taken to safeguard against potential exploits.
